Brief History
The Grand Theatre is the third oldest working theatre in the whole of the UK and has seen a vast amount of change since it first opened its doors in 1782. Simply known as the “Theatre” it played host to a number of great actors and actresses including Sarah Siddons.
Disaster struck in 1908 when a fire, which is believed to have started in the cottages used to accommodate the actors. The whole side of the theatre was gutted by the fire and it was forced to close.
By 1920 the theatre was back up and running with regular performances from the Lancaster Footlights, they brought the theatre in 1950 in order to save it from demolition.
